Remembering Columbian novelist Gabriel Garcia Marquez

Columbian novelist Gabriel Garcia Marquez passed away yesterday in his home in Mexico City at age 87. Marquez was a Nobel Prize winner and arguably one of the most important writers of the 20th century.
